After rolling in under the shine of headlights the previous night the group is ready for another trail day in Pike County, Illinois situated near the Hopewell Winery. With steep climbs covered with still more slick mud the crew attacked the Atlas Trail beginning with a twisty hill climb called the Pin Ball, then the rocky boulder crawl called Bad Dog where wheel speed, suspension travel, and plenty of power are a necessity. After climbing Atlas they must tackle The Mystery Trail featuring a crawl through a creek and ending with an obstacle known as the Can Opener.
Next up was another road day eventually leading the group out of Illinois and into Missouri the final official state of this year’s Ultimate Adventure. Oddly, until day 7, no ferries or ferry crossings had been encountered by the clan, but that was quick to change.

I've never done any off roading so excuse my ignorance, but I thought wheel spin is bad for grip? why is everyone flooring it?
@Clutchkickhunter
8 жыл бұрын
Since it is muddy, tires will have no traction anyways. So, the only thing they can do is keep up momentum by flooring it and not letting off until they reach the top.
@gwot
8 жыл бұрын
WyRsCrew'sClips I see that as a lack of skill (not saying i have these skills), because tire spin has less grip than less tire spin, because all i see in these videos is EXCESSIVE wheel spin. best case scenario based on physics is to keep the tires moving without excessive tire spin, so you'd keep your momentum. So am i still missing something or is that pretty much it?
@lucianoballista7412
8 жыл бұрын
Good luck climbing steep hills with no wheelspeed and MT tires turned into racing slicks due to mud stuck into the tire tracks. If your theory was true then @7:22 he would have plenty of traction and would not need a winch. There is NO traction when your tires are completely covered in mud. The wheel spin cleans the tire tracks and give you a bit more than 0 traction.
